The admission process for the Master of Business Administration (MBA) program at Balaji Institute of International Business (BIIB) is a comprehensive procedure that includes several steps. Below, you’ll find an overview of the typical admission process at BIIB:

Eligibility Criteria Check for MBA at Balaji Institute of International Business:

Before applying, ensure that you meet the eligibility criteria set by BIIB for the MBA program. Common eligibility criteria often include a bachelor’s degree in any discipline from a recognized university, a competitive entrance exam score, and English language proficiency.

Before applying for the Master of Business Administration (MBA) program at Balaji Institute of International Business (BIIB), it’s essential to perform an eligibility criteria check to ensure that you meet the institute’s requirements. While specific eligibility criteria may vary from year to year, the following are typical eligibility criteria that applicants are required to meet:

Bachelor’s Degree: Applicants should have completed a bachelor’s degree from a recognized university or institution. The degree should typically be a minimum of three years in duration.

Minimum Percentage: BIIB may have specific minimum percentage requirements in the qualifying bachelor’s degree. The minimum percentage may vary by program and can depend on the prevailing admission criteria.

Entrance Exam Score: Most MBA programs at BIIB require a valid score in a recognized national-level management entrance exam. Common exams include CAT (Common Admission Test), XAT (Xavier Aptitude Test), MAT (Management Aptitude Test), CMAT (Common Management Admission Test), or BIIB’s own entrance test. Applicants should check which exam scores are accepted for the specific program they are interested in.

English Language Proficiency: For programs conducted in English, international applicants may be required to demonstrate English language proficiency through tests like IELTS or TOEFL. Specific requirements may apply.

Work Experience (if required): Some MBA programs at BIIB may have a work experience requirement. Applicants should check if the program they are interested in requires prior work experience and meet the specified criteria.

Statement of Purpose (SOP): Applicants may be required to submit a Statement of Purpose (SOP) or essays. These documents typically discuss the applicant’s goals, aspirations, and reasons for pursuing an MBA at BIIB.

Entrance Exam Cutoff: BIIB may set a minimum cutoff score in the entrance exam. Applicants should check if they meet the cutoff score specified for their chosen program.

Performance in Group Discussion and Personal Interview (GD-PI): Shortlisted candidates are generally required to participate in a Group Discussion (GD) and a Personal Interview (PI) as part of the selection process. Performance in these rounds is an important factor in the final admission decision.

Academic Records: Academic records, including past academic performance and achievements, may also be considered during the selection process.

Program-Specific Requirements: Certain MBA programs at BIIB may have specific eligibility criteria based on the program’s focus and requirements. Applicants should carefully review the program’s admission brochure for any program-specific requirements.

It’s important to note that the eligibility criteria can change from year to year and may vary depending on the program and other factors. Therefore, applicants are advised to refer to the official BIIB website and the program’s admission brochure for the most up-to-date and accurate eligibility requirements for the MBA program they are interested in.

Application Form Submission:

Start by obtaining the application form, either through the BIIB website or from the institute directly. Complete the application form with accurate and detailed information.

Entrance Exam Scores:

BIIB typically considers scores from national-level MBA entrance exams such as CAT (Common Admission Test), XAT (Xavier Aptitude Test), MAT (Management Aptitude Test), CMAT (Common Management Admission Test), or the institute’s own entrance exam. Submit your valid test scores along with the application.

Group Discussion and Personal Interview (GD-PI):

Shortlisted candidates are usually invited to participate in a Group Discussion (GD) and a Personal Interview (PI) as part of the selection process. The GD assesses your communication and teamwork skills, while the PI evaluates your personality, motivation, and suitability for the MBA program.

Academic Records and Work Experience for MBA at Balaji Institute of International Business:

Your academic records, including previous academic performance and relevant work experience, may be considered during the selection process. Make sure to provide accurate information regarding your academic and professional background.

Statement of Purpose (SOP) or Essays:

BIIB may require you to submit a Statement of Purpose (SOP) or essays. These documents allow you to express your goals, aspirations, and reasons for pursuing an MBA at the institute.

Final Selection for MBA at Balaji Institute of International Business:

Based on your performance in the entrance exam, GD-PI, academic records, work experience, and other relevant criteria, BIIB will make the final selection for admission to the MBA program.

Admission Offer:

If you are selected, you will receive an admission offer from BIIB. This offer will include details regarding the program, fees, and any other specific requirements for enrollment.

Acceptance of Admission Offer:

To secure your seat, you will need to accept the admission offer and pay the required admission fee within the stipulated timeframe.

Enrollment and Orientation:

Once you have accepted the admission offer and paid the fees, you will be formally enrolled in the MBA program. The institute typically conducts an orientation program to welcome and acquaint new students with the campus and program details.

It’s important to note that the specific admission process may vary from year to year and can be subject to changes. Therefore, it’s advisable to check the official BIIB website and the admission brochure for the most up-to-date and accurate information on the MBA admission process.
